Our Heart and Mission

1. Mission Statement

  • To re-invite God to dominate and rule in our shared spaces.

  • To establish businesses and community hubs as prayer locations nationally and globally.

  • To cultivate a selfless, collaborative environment for individual growth and collective resilience.

  • To share resources across housing, health, finance, transportation, employment, R&D, counseling, and legal support.

  • To create self-sustaining communities prepared for crises such as pandemics.

    2. Core Values

    • Faith First: God’s presence as the guiding principle.

    • Selflessness: Prioritizing community needs over individual gain.

    • Collaboration: Working across cultures, professions, and geographies.

    • Resilience: Building systems that endure crises.

    • Inclusivity: Welcoming all who share the mission, regardless of background.

      3. Organizational Structure

      • Global Council: Oversees vision, faith alignment, and international expansion.

      • Regional Chapters: Local hubs for prayer, resource-sharing, and community projects.

      • Leadership Roles:

        • Spiritual Leaders (prayer and guidance)

        • Resource Coordinators (housing, health, finance, etc.)

        • Community Builders (events, outreach, storytelling)

        • Emergency Preparedness Officers (resilience planning)

          4. Membership

          • Eligibility: Open to individuals, families, and businesses aligned with the mission.

          • Commitments:

            • Participation in prayer gatherings.

            • Contribution of time, skills, or resources.

            • Upholding values of faith, collaboration, and inclusivity.

          • Rights: Access to shared resources, counseling, and community support.

Glocal Saints are devoted members of the Alpha and Omega Saints Association, a global grassroots movement committed to advancing the unity of the faith as revealed in Ephesians 4:11–16.

We believe unity is not an abstract ideal — it is a calling. That’s why we combine spiritual purpose with practical action, bringing hope through hands‑on humanitarian programs that uplift communities across the world.

Our mission is to reach, strengthen, and unify the Saints of the Philadelphia Church described in Revelation 3:7–13 — believers known for their faithfulness, endurance, and steadfast love. Many today are weighed down by tradition, religion, and doctrines of men that hinder spiritual renewal. We exist to help them rediscover the simplicity, power, and purity of the Kingdom message.

In short: We unite. We serve. We restore hope. We build a global family of believers who walk in truth, compassion, and spiritual maturity.
